Teacher of Health and Social Care – Haven High Academy, Boston, Lincolnshire, MPS/UPS

Job to start: September 2020 – Full time permanent role

Due to the continuing expansion and success of Haven High Academy, we are seeking to appoint a Teacher of Health and Social Care Level 2.

Haven High Academy is oversubscribed with 1,170 students and is situated in Boston, rural Lincolnshire and is part of the Boston Witham Academies Federation.

Our mission is: “To create a centre of excellence within and for the community which raises the aspirations and achievement of all stakeholders – an academy which provides support, care, guidance, challenge and empowerment for all.”

We offer a friendly, supportive working environment, which values talented, committed staff and offers excellent professional development opportunities to assist with career progression.

We are looking to appoint a colleague who is:-

• A talented and dynamic teacher to inspire our students from KS3 to KS4. Health and Social Care is taught in Years 9 to 11.

• Highly motivated, innovative and committed to achieving outstanding results

• A good/outstanding practitioner with a working knowledge of the BTEC Tech award in HSC

• Able to plan and teach internally moderated units (Human lifespan development, health and social care services)

• Able to prepare students for the external synoptic unit Health and Wellbeing

• A professional teacher who understands the importance of best practice and the status of the academy in the community

Haven High Academy is an oversubscribed,  co-educational, non-denominational secondary in Boston, Lincolnshire. The school is a member of the Voyage Education Partnership.  As of the most recent inspection there were nearly 1,500 students on the school roll.

Headteacher

James Myhill-Johnson

Values and vision

The academy's core purpose is to provide students with a world class education to ensure they enter the world of work, or higher education, with the required skills to be successful. Staff care passionately about each individual member of the Academy community and take great pride in working together as a team to ensure individual success is achieved.

The school offers an exciting mix of academic, vocational and co-curricular activities aimed at developing each child holistically - whilst also effectively preparing them for a successful future life.

Haven High Academy attaches huge importance to developing the individual characteristics of its core values: Progress, Resilience, Integrity, Discipline and Excellence (PRIDE).

Ofsted

Pupils and parents speak highly of the pastoral support in the school. The most recent full Ofsted report states: "Pupils are happy and feel safe."
